## Cold starts

If Fernwheel handlers feel sluggish after a quiet stretch, that's a cold start — don't panic. Run the prewarm script to ping each handler twice; latency should settle within a minute. The script talks to the internal warm-up service, so it needs the ops key, which you'll find right below.

app token of tagef-tafog = qvz3-7n0

**Runbook: Account Recovery — Feedwright Validator Service**

Applies when the Feedwright podcast feed validator's service account is locked out after a credential rotation. Release manager: confirm the validator pods are failing auth in the Brackenhall console, then pause the publish queue so malformed feeds are not waved through. Initiate recovery from the admin panel under Service Accounts → Feedwright → Recover. When prompted for the recovery input, supply the passphrase shown directly below this section.

strongbox words: norwyn-wenael-aldvan-aldiel-wendor-holael

When two Lanternwick agents write to the same calendar shard, the conflict resolver picks the event with the newer vector clock and quietly discards the other, which surfaces as "vanishing meetings" in user reports. First, confirm the conflict counter is climbing on the shard dashboard. Then pause the secondary agent, replay the discarded-events journal, and verify both writers agree on the merge window. Before re-enabling sync, ensure the resolver is running with these configuration values.

service settings:
novath:
  pin: 1396
  tenant: pelys
  seal: seal_ccc035e1
  metrics_host: metrics.novath.qorvelworks.test
  standby_team: fraeth
  escalation: drueth-zorok
  nonce: 61d508

// Notes for the weekly eng sync re: Gallerywhisper, our museum audio-guide app.
// This constant sets the prefetch radius for exhibit audio clips. At the
// Hollen Pavilion pilot we learned visitors walk faster than our original
// estimate, so clips were buffering mid-stride. Bumping this to three rooms
// ahead fixed it, at a modest bandwidth cost. Don't lower it without testing
// on the slow gallery wifi first — seriously, it's painful. The trace token
// from the pilot build that validated this number is appended just below.

trace token, kahap-bagaf: htk4_8458